Luxury slow fashion label, Laura Ironside, have launched a new ‘Lease’ service to reduce the environmental impact of their garments. The UK wide service hires out beautiful clothing to clients’ offering  sustainable alternative to fast fashion.

At lauraironside.com you can order your clothes like at any online retailer, however with their new ‘Lease’ service, clients can rent garments for just as long as they need them. Renting clothes from Laura Ironside is a remedy for mass consumption that harms the planet. The ‘Lease’ service also lets customers wear luxury fashion for a fraction of the cost.

Director Laura Ironside said, “We’re aiming for more circular business models. We design clothes for a longer life span while reducing material use and carbon dioxide emissions. Garments are better made and longer wearing as a result. While everyone loves a wardrobe that is regularly updated, a new generation of customers are rethinking the definition of ownership and prefer to rent. With garment leasing you can update and curate your wardrobe ethically for less.”

Recent ‘Leasing’ customer Sara said, “Clothes like these should be living, not locked n a wardrobe. Leasing from Laura Ironside is a wonderful way to access sustainable luxury and it is a more personal way to dip your toe into fashion rental, which is a positive move for the planet.”

 


 

Laura Ironside is a slow fashion label based in Glasgow and manufacturing in London. They create beautiful garments, thoughtfully, and to a high standard through sensitive and sustainable manufacturing.
